Section 01

Neighborhood Overview

Mc Cree Swimming Pool is situated in the northeast quadrant of Dallas, specifically within the charming Lake Highlands neighborhood. This area is well-connected by major thoroughfares, making it accessible from various parts of the city. Plano Road, the pool's primary address, runs north-south and provides direct access to major east-west arteries like Royal Lane and Forest Lane. These roads, in turn, connect to the larger highway network, including Highway 75 (North Central Expressway) and Interstate 635 (Lyndon B. Johnson Freeway), both crucial for navigating Dallas. Driving to Mc Cree Pool from Dallas Love Field Airport (DAL) typically takes around 25-35 minutes, depending on traffic, while Dallas/Fort Worth International Airport (DFW) is a bit further, usually 30-45 minutes away. Public transportation options are available, with Dallas Area Rapid Transit (DART) buses serving the Plano Road corridor, offering a viable alternative for those who prefer not to drive. Smart arrival tactics often involve checking local traffic reports, especially during peak hours or major Dallas events, and factoring in a buffer of 15-20 minutes for parking and finding your way to the pool entrance.

Section 08

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Winter in Dallas brings cool to chilly temperatures, with average highs in the 50s and lows in the 30s. While swimming is unlikely outdoors, crisp days are perfect for enjoying the nearby parks or indoor attractions. Visitors should pack layers, including sweaters, jackets, and comfortable walking shoes, as outdoor activities may require warmth.

🌱

Spring & early summer

Spring temperatures are pleasantly mild, gradually warming into the 70s and 80s. This period is excellent for swimming and outdoor exploration before the intense summer heat sets in. Light jackets or sweaters are useful for cooler evenings, while shorts and t-shirts are standard for daytime activities.

☀️

Mid-summer

Mid-summer in Dallas is hot and humid, with daily highs frequently reaching the 90s and sometimes exceeding 100 degrees Fahrenheit. The pool becomes a major draw during these months. Lightweight, breathable clothing is essential, and constant hydration is critical. Sunscreen and hats are highly recommended for any outdoor time.

🍂

Fall season

Fall offers a welcome respite from summer heat, with temperatures typically in the 70s and 80s, gradually cooling through October and November. This season is ideal for outdoor activities and sports. Similar to spring, layers are advised, with warmer clothing needed as the season progresses towards winter.

📅

Rain & snow

Dallas experiences moderate rainfall throughout the year, with heavier periods often occurring in spring and fall. Thunderstorms are common during warmer months and can arise suddenly. Snow is infrequent but can occur in winter, typically resulting in brief accumulations. Rain or snow can impact outdoor pool operations and travel conditions, necessitating checks for closures or delays.
